Gamma globulin complexes in synovial fluids of patients with rheumatoid arthritis. Partial characterization and relationship to lowered complement levels.

作者信息

Winchester R J, Agnello V, Kunkel H G

出版信息

Clin Exp Immunol. 1970 May;6(5):689-706.

Abstract

Gamma globulin complexes were demonstrable in certain joint fluids from patients with rheumatoid arthritis by analytic and density gradient centrifugation. They form a continuum of high molecular weight components ranging from 7S to 30S and were dissociable primarily to 7S γG globulin. The larger complexes were also detectable by precipitation reactions with C1q and with γM rheumatoid factor. This permitted the isolation and partial characterization of the complexes. Non-immunoglobulin constituents were not detectable. Evidence was obtained that 7S γG globulin rheumatoid factors represented an important constituent of the complexes. A relationship was encountered between the amount of γ globulin complex present in the joint fluids and diminution in total haemolytic complement activity. All fluids with abundant γ globulin complexes contained markedly lowered complement levels. A decrease in levels of C1q and β was found to correlate with the amount of γG globulin complexes. Although patients who had diminished complement levels in their joint fluid have serum γM rheumatoid factor, its titre does not correlate well with the extent of complement depression. Joint fluids with abundant γ globulin complexes manifested an anticomplementary effect. This activity was most apparent at 37°C when fresh rheumatoid serum was used as a source of complement. Evidence indicating the participation of γM rheumatoid factor in this anticomplementary effect was obtained. All fluids with significant anticomplementary activity formed precipitin bands with C1q on agarose plates. γM rheumatoid factor was not necessary for this reaction.

通过分析性和密度梯度离心法,在类风湿性关节炎患者的某些关节液中可检测到γ球蛋白复合物。它们形成了一个从7S到30S的高分子量成分连续体,主要可解离为7SγG球蛋白。较大的复合物也可通过与C1q和γM类风湿因子的沉淀反应检测到。这使得复合物得以分离并进行部分特性鉴定。未检测到非免疫球蛋白成分。有证据表明7SγG球蛋白类风湿因子是复合物的重要组成部分。在关节液中存在的γ球蛋白复合物的量与总溶血补体活性的降低之间存在关联。所有含有丰富γ球蛋白复合物的液体中补体水平均显著降低。发现C1q和β水平的降低与γG球蛋白复合物的量相关。尽管关节液中补体水平降低的患者有血清γM类风湿因子,但其滴度与补体降低程度的相关性并不好。含有丰富γ球蛋白复合物的关节液表现出抗补体作用。当使用新鲜类风湿血清作为补体来源时,这种活性在37°C时最为明显。获得了表明γM类风湿因子参与这种抗补体作用的证据。所有具有显著抗补体活性的液体在琼脂糖平板上与C1q形成沉淀带。γM类风湿因子对于该反应并非必需。
